VERY QUICK AND EASY BANANA BREAD

This Banana Bread recipe went down really well at my local toddler group. I often make it with my own children because it is a very child-friendly recipe..easy to get them involved in the preparation. Plus it is filled with some really good stuff (if you don’t mind the sugar!).
What you need:
· 1-1/2 cups plain flour
· 3 teaspoons baking powder
· 1/3 cup oil ( I like to use olive oil-but regular vegetable oil works well too) ·
2 teaspoons cinnamon
· 1/2 cup sugar
· 2 medium eggs, well beaten
· 1/4 cup brown sugar
· 3/4 cup oatmeal
· 1/2 teaspoon baking soda
· 1/4 cup milk
· 2 cups mashed bananas (about 3 really ripe bananas)
What to do:
1. Mix everything in one bowl and stir it up. Pour mixture into a greased and floured loaf tin and bake at 180C for 50-60 minutes.
OR
If you prefer Banana muffins, spoon the mixture into muffin cases in your muffin tin and bake at 180C for 15 minutes.
